Output 06ddaa8953f311b6b7440b6b83c512a630b91b4cb7572a8d9531cb7bf5d42be3:15

value
142762
script pubkey
OP_0 OP_PUSHBYTES_20 2d025098d3de25dbe87d60fb4f274890b9e97907
address
bc1q95p9pxxnmcjah6ravra57f6gjzu7j7g85pgvh6
transaction
06ddaa8953f311b6b7440b6b83c512a630b91b4cb7572a8d9531cb7bf5d42be3